Output ecaa569b04e9e59c68503cfb349a3a17c4d8a48ef869e8af1d980b76d0070511:2

value
1021516
script pubkey
OP_0 OP_PUSHBYTES_20 f910c43a864ae71eb9f2d3d35a310aebca30070d
address
bc1qlygvgw5xftn3aw0j60f45vg2a09rqpcdagmfsp
transaction
ecaa569b04e9e59c68503cfb349a3a17c4d8a48ef869e8af1d980b76d0070511
spent
true